Book Description:

American folk music is a rich vein of America's cultural resources. This book will help your readers develop an appreciation for it. In the past it embraced styles as diverse as spirituals and polkas, breakdowns and ballads, Tex-Mex corridos, and the songs of the cowboy. Today, folk music continues to absorb new influences and to evolve in exciting and unexpected ways.
